Athens Police Arrest Bulgarian Woman Carrying 2.5 kg of Cocaine at Airport

cocaine-cartelOn Friday the police at Athens International Airport arrested a Bulgarian woman who had hidden a total of 2.5 kilograms of cocaine in packages of powdered ice-cream, authorities have announced.
The 29-year-old woman had traveled from the capital of Bulgaria, Sofia, to Athens, then went on to Rio de Janeiro for around 10 days before returning to Athens.
It was upon her return from Rio that she was busted by police for carrying the cocaine in her luggage.
There is speculation from authorities that the woman was being used as a mule and was meant to deliver the drugs to a contact in Greece, although she stated that she planned on taking the bus from Athens to Sophia.
There is growing concern over an international drug smuggling network that is believed to have strong connections in Bulgaria, Greece and Brazil.
The woman has been arrested as investigators continue to look into the details of the case and any connections with drug smuggling rings.
